Subject: [PATCH 2/2] io_uring: provide IORING_ENTER_SQ_WAIT for SQPOLL SQ ring waits
Date: Thu,  3 Sep 2020 18:02:29 -0600	[thread overview]
Message-ID: <[email protected]> (raw)
In-Reply-To: <[email protected]>

When using SQPOLL, applications can run into the issue of running out of
SQ ring entries because the thread hasn't consumed them yet. The only
option for dealing with that is checking later, or busy checking for the
condition.

Provide IORING_ENTER_SQ_WAIT if applications want to wait on this
condition.

diff --git a/fs/io_uring.c b/fs/io_uring.c
index 7a3f10a9329a..44c11bdc0dc7 100644
--- a/fs/io_uring.c
+++ b/fs/io_uring.c
@@ -304,6 +304,7 @@ struct io_ring_ctx {
 
 	struct wait_queue_entry	sqo_wait_entry;
 	struct list_head	sqd_list;
+	struct wait_queue_head	sqo_sq_wait;
 
 	struct io_sq_data	*sq_data;	/* if using sq thread polling */
 
@@ -1094,6 +1095,7 @@ static struct io_ring_ctx *io_ring_ctx_alloc(struct io_uring_params *p)
 		goto err;
 
 	ctx->flags = p->flags;
+	init_waitqueue_head(&ctx->sqo_sq_wait);
 	INIT_LIST_HEAD(&ctx->sqd_list);
 	init_waitqueue_head(&ctx->cq_wait);
 	INIT_LIST_HEAD(&ctx->cq_overflow_list);
@@ -1324,6 +1326,13 @@ static void io_commit_cqring(struct io_ring_ctx *ctx)
 		__io_queue_deferred(ctx);
 }
 
+static inline bool io_sqring_full(struct io_ring_ctx *ctx)
+{
+	struct io_rings *r = ctx->rings;
+
+	return READ_ONCE(r->sq.tail) - ctx->cached_sq_head == r->sq_ring_entries;
+}
+
 static struct io_uring_cqe *io_get_cqring(struct io_ring_ctx *ctx)
 {
 	struct io_rings *rings = ctx->rings;
@@ -6673,6 +6682,10 @@ static enum sq_ret __io_sq_thread(struct io_ring_ctx *ctx,
 	if (likely(!percpu_ref_is_dying(&ctx->refs)))
 		ret = io_submit_sqes(ctx, to_submit, NULL, -1);
 	mutex_unlock(&ctx->uring_lock);
+
+	if (!io_sqring_full(ctx) && wq_has_sleeper(&ctx->sqo_sq_wait))
+		wake_up(&ctx->sqo_sq_wait);
+
 	return SQT_DID_WORK;
 }
 
@@ -8124,8 +8137,7 @@ static __poll_t io_uring_poll(struct file *file, poll_table *wait)
 	 * io_commit_cqring
 	 */
 	smp_rmb();
-	if (READ_ONCE(ctx->rings->sq.tail) - ctx->cached_sq_head !=
-	    ctx->rings->sq_ring_entries)
+	if (!io_sqring_full(ctx))
 		mask |= EPOLLOUT | EPOLLWRNORM;
 	if (io_cqring_events(ctx, false))
 		mask |= EPOLLIN | EPOLLRDNORM;
@@ -8448,6 +8460,25 @@ static unsigned long io_uring_nommu_get_unmapped_area(struct file *file,
 
 #endif /* !CONFIG_MMU */
 
+static void io_sqpoll_wait_sq(struct io_ring_ctx *ctx)
+{
+	DEFINE_WAIT(wait);
+
+	do {
+		if (!io_sqring_full(ctx))
+			break;
+
+		prepare_to_wait(&ctx->sqo_sq_wait, &wait, TASK_INTERRUPTIBLE);
+
+		if (!io_sqring_full(ctx))
+			break;
+
+		schedule();
+	} while (!signal_pending(current));
+
+	finish_wait(&ctx->sqo_sq_wait, &wait);
+}
+
 SYSCALL_DEFINE6(io_uring_enter, unsigned int, fd, u32, to_submit,
 		u32, min_complete, u32, flags, const sigset_t __user *, sig,
 		size_t, sigsz)
@@ -8459,7 +8490,8 @@ SYSCALL_DEFINE6(io_uring_enter, unsigned int, fd, u32, to_submit,
 
 	io_run_task_work();
 
-	if (flags & ~(IORING_ENTER_GETEVENTS | IORING_ENTER_SQ_WAKEUP))
+	if (flags & ~(IORING_ENTER_GETEVENTS | IORING_ENTER_SQ_WAKEUP |
+			IORING_ENTER_SQ_WAIT))
 		return -EINVAL;
 
 	f = fdget(fd);
@@ -8489,6 +8521,8 @@ SYSCALL_DEFINE6(io_uring_enter, unsigned int, fd, u32, to_submit,
 			io_cqring_overflow_flush(ctx, false);
 		if (flags & IORING_ENTER_SQ_WAKEUP)
 			wake_up(&ctx->sq_data->wait);
+		if (flags & IORING_ENTER_SQ_WAIT)
+			io_sqpoll_wait_sq(ctx);
 		submitted = to_submit;
 	} else if (to_submit) {
 		mutex_lock(&ctx->uring_lock);
diff --git a/include/uapi/linux/io_uring.h b/include/uapi/linux/io_uring.h
index 1112c0f05641..7539d912690b 100644
--- a/include/uapi/linux/io_uring.h
+++ b/include/uapi/linux/io_uring.h
@@ -225,6 +225,7 @@ struct io_cqring_offsets {
  */
 #define IORING_ENTER_GETEVENTS	(1U << 0)
 #define IORING_ENTER_SQ_WAKEUP	(1U << 1)
+#define IORING_ENTER_SQ_WAIT	(1U << 2)
